What's Happening?
The Wright State basketball team achieved a 76-69 victory over the Milwaukee Panthers in a recent game. TJ Burch led the Raiders with 18 points and four steals, contributing significantly to their win.
Dominic Pangonis added 16 points and five rebounds, while Michael Cooper scored 13 points, including three successful three-point shots. The Panthers, despite their efforts, were unable to overcome Wright State's performance, with Amar Augillard leading Milwaukee with 19 points and eight rebounds. Aaron Franklin also contributed 13 points for the Panthers. This victory improves Wright State's record to 14-8 overall and 9-2 in the Horizon League, while Milwaukee's record stands at 9-14 overall and 5-7 in the league.
